Loading Ramps: Features and Maintenance of Mobile Loading Ramps

I. Features of Mobile Hydraulic Loading Ramps

1. The electric control operation is very simple. For example, with the Xiamen mobile loading ramp, you only need to press a button, and the adjustment plate will automatically rise; when you release the button, the adjustment plate will descend by its own weight. You can use it by placing the hinged connecting plate on the truck.

2. The hydraulic system uses high-quality brand products originally imported from Italy, with excellent performance and very little maintenance required for mobile loading ramps.

3. Through the power system, the large cylinder raises the entire ramp. When it reaches the top position, the small cylinder starts to work, smoothly extending the hinged connecting plate. The height adjustment plates are all made of high-quality patterned steel plates and profiles from Baosteel in Shanghai, and are tightly welded together for a long lifespan.

II. Material Selection of Mobile Loading Ramps

1. Cylinders: High-precision, wear-resistant cylinders;

2. Main frame: Made of specially designed shaped steel pipes;

3. Platform material: The platform uses anti-slip mesh;

4. Tires: High-strength, high-load capacity, high-pressure tires;

III. Loading Ramp Maintenance

1. Inspect the hydraulic and pipeline connections of the mobile loading ramp. Damaged pipelines should be replaced immediately; tighten pipe joints if loose.

2. Remove and disassemble the lowering valve, clean the valve core with compressed air, and reinstall it.

IV. Daily Management of Loading Ramps

1. Strengthen the inspection and daily maintenance of the loading ramp, regularly maintain and manage, understand the equipment's operating status, and promptly identify any abnormal phenomena.

2. If a drop in the hydraulic oil level is found during daily checks, check all oil pipes, hoses and sealing surfaces in the hydraulic system for leaks.

3. Conduct status checks on the loading ramp's hydraulic system, promptly understand the loading ramp's operating status, locate malfunctions and their causes.

4. Strengthen oil quality supervision, regularly drain waste and clean accumulated water, oil sludge and other impurities from the drain points and oil tank, and regularly turn on the oil filter to maintain oil cleanliness.

V. Use of Fixed Loading Ramps

Fixed loading ramps are mainly composed of a connecting plate, panel, base frame, safety baffle, support foot, lifting cylinder, control box, and hydraulic station. Fixed loading ramps are loading and unloading auxiliary equipment used with warehouse platforms. They are integrated with the platform and can be adjusted according to different heights of truck bodies, both higher and lower, facilitating forklift entry into the truck body. The equipment uses imported hydraulic pump stations, and has anti-crushing side skirts on both sides for safer operation and increased efficiency. Advantages of fixed loading ramps: Electric hydraulic, simple operation, freely adjustable height, large adjustment range, improved loading and unloading efficiency, and reduced labor.

VI. Loading Ramp Operation Method:

1. First, open the car's tailgate and fasten it to both sides of the truck body. Then, reverse the car close to the anti-collision pads on both sides of the loading ramp pit, and brake the car.

2. Turn on the main power switch in the control box, press the operation button, and the fixed loading ramp panel will slowly rise. When it reaches a higher height, the front connecting plate of the loading ramp will begin to extend. When the connecting plate rises to the same plane as the panel, release the button, and the panel and connecting plate will slowly descend in the same plane, and the connecting plate will naturally rest on the bottom surface of the rear of the car. The contact area should be no less than 100 mm.

3. If the bottom surface of the truck body is lower than the height of the platform where the loading ramp is installed, while releasing the button to lower the panel, tighten the small chain to move the support foot away from the support foot pad recess, and the panel and connecting plate can be lowered to a position below the platform height, until the connecting plate lands on the lower bottom surface of the truck body.

4. After work is completed, press the operation button, the panel and connecting plate will rise together, the car drives away, release the button, and the panel will automatically fall back into place.

5. Then turn off the main power switch.

VII. Safety Precautions for Using Loading Ramps:

1. The loading ramp must be operated and maintained by a designated person, and unskilled personnel must not operate it without authorization.

2. No personnel may enter under the loading ramp frame or between the safety baffles to perform other operations while the loading ramp is in operation, to avoid danger!

3. Overloading is strictly prohibited.

4. Do not press the operation button while the loading ramp is loading or unloading.

5. After the connecting plate is fully extended, release the operation button immediately to prevent the cylinder from being under pressure for a long time.

6. If any abnormal situation occurs during operation, troubleshoot the problem before use; do not force use.

7. When repairing or maintaining, use the safety support rod correctly.

8. The vehicle must be braked and stopped during loading and unloading operations with the loading ramp.

Introduction to the civil engineering advantages of rail-guided lifting platforms

Guide rail lifting platform is a kind of non-scissor hydraulic lifting mechanical equipment, used for cargo transmission between floors of two or three-story industrial plants, restaurants, and hotels. It can have a low height of 150-300mm, especially suitable for workplaces where pits cannot be excavated, and does not require upper suspension points. It comes in various forms (single-column, double-column, four-column). The equipment operates smoothly. The guide rails of the guide rail lifting platform are generally made of channel steel, I-beams, and square tubes welded together. It is simple, reliable, and economical for cargo transmission. Hydraulic lifting platforms are multifunctional lifting and handling mechanical equipment with lifting heights ranging from 1m to 30m. They can also be customized according to different user needs.
